Shrimp and Asparagus Bowl with Creamy Garlic Sauce Recipe

This Shrimp Bowl with Asparagus is a flavorful and elegant meal featuring grilled shrimp and asparagus paired with a creamy garlic Parmesan sauce. Marinated shrimp are grilled to perfection alongside tender asparagus, then combined and topped with a rich, cheesy sauce for a satisfying dish that’s perfect for any occasion.

Ingredients

Scale

Shrimp Marinade

  • 1 lb large sh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 4 cloves fresh gar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• ¼ te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es (optional)

Grilled Asparagus

  • 1 lb asparagus, trimmed
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Creamy Garlic Sauce

  • Remaining minced garlic from preparation
  • ½ cup heavy cream
  • 2 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Shrimp: In a large mixing bowl, combine 1 tablespoon olive oil, minced garlic, kosher salt, black pepper, and optional crushed red pepper flakes. Add the peeled and deveined shrimp and toss well to coat evenly. Allow the shrimp to marinate for 30 minutes to absorb the flavors.
  2. Grill the Asparagus: Preheat your grill to medium-high heat. Drizzle the trimmed asparagus with 1 tablespoon ol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Grill the asparagus for 4-5 minutes, turning occasionally until tender and slightly charred for a smoky flavor.
  3. Grill the Shrimp: Place the marinated shrimp on the preheated grill. Cook the shrimp for 2-3 minutes on each side until they become bright pink and opaque, indicating they are fully cooked.
  4. Make the Creamy Garlic Sauce: In a skillet over medium heat, sauté the remaining minced garlic briefly, then pour in the heavy cream. Stir constantly and add the grated Parmesan cheese, continuing to stir until the cheese is fully melted and the sauce is smooth. For extra depth of flavor, incorporate any leftover marinade into the sauce.
  5. Assemble and Serve: In serving bowls, layer the grilled asparagus and grilled shrimp. Drizzle generously with the creamy garlic Parmesan sauce and serve immediately for the best taste.

Notes

  • Marinating the shrimp enhances the flavor significantly; do not skip this step.
  • Use fresh garlic for the best aromatic results in both the marinade and sauce.
  • If you don’t have a grill, the shrimp and asparagus can be cooked on a grill pan or broiled in the oven.
  • Adjust crushed red pepper flakes to control spice level or omit for a milder dish.
  • For a lighter version, substitute heavy cream with half-and-half or a dairy-free cream alternative.
